Why Garage Door Maintenance Matters

Your garage door moves up and down roughly 1,400 times per year. That's a lot of wear on springs, cables, rollers, and hinges. Without routine inspection and care, small issues snowball into expensive ones fast.

Think of it like your car. You wouldn't skip oil changes and expect your engine to last, right? Same principle applies here. A well-maintained garage door operates quietly, safely, and reliably. A neglected one? That's how you end up needing emergency service when you're already running late.

Regular maintenance also catches safety hazards before they become dangerous. Worn cables, broken springs, and misaligned tracks can cause the door to fall unexpectedly. This is especially critical if you have kids or pets in your home. Our inspection process identifies these risks so you can address them proactively rather than reactively.

What a Garage Door Tune-Up Includes

A professional tune-up is more thorough than most homeowners realize. We start with a complete inspection of springs, cables, rollers, hinges, and the track alignment. We check the balance of the door itself. If it's too heavy or too light, your opener works harder than necessary, shortening its lifespan.

Lubrication is the cornerstone of good maintenance. The right lubricant on hinges, rollers, and springs reduces friction and noise. But here's the catch: not all lubricants work equally well. We use commercial-grade products that won't attract dirt or gum up over time. Most homeowners grab WD-40 and call it done, but that actually dries out metal components and causes more problems.

We also test the opener's balance and reverse function. Modern openers have safety sensors that stop the door if something blocks its path. These need to be verified during every inspection. A faulty sensor is a genuine hazard.

Cost and Frequency

How often should you get maintenance done? Once or twice per year is the sweet spot for most Laguna Woods homes. If you use your garage door heavily, lean toward two visits annually (spring and fall work well). Light users can often get by with one annual visit.

The cost of a basic inspection and tune-up typically runs between $150 and $250, depending on what repairs are needed. That sounds like money out of pocket, but compare it to the cost of replacing broken springs (they run $300 to $600 each) or an emergency garage door repair call. Regular maintenance pays for itself.

We also recommend calling for an inspection if you've experienced extreme weather lately. Orange County's summer heat and occasional winter rains can affect garage doors. Lubrication dries faster in heat, and moisture can cause rust on metal parts.

Frequently Asked Questions

How long do garage door springs last without maintenance? Springs typically last 7 to 9 years with proper lubrication and care. Without maintenance, they can fail within 5 to 7 years due to increased friction and rust. Regular tune-ups add years to their lifespan and keep repair costs predictable.

Can I do garage door maintenance myself? Basic tasks like visual inspections are safe for homeowners. However, never attempt to adjust springs, cables, or the door balance yourself. These components are under extreme tension and can cause serious injury. Leave those tasks to professionals.

What's the difference between maintenance and repair? Maintenance is preventive care: inspection, lubrication, and adjustment. Repair fixes broken or damaged parts. Maintenance reduces the need for repairs. Think of it as health checkups versus treating illness after it develops.

Do smart garage doors need different maintenance? Smart features like app control and sensors require the same mechanical maintenance as standard doors. However, you should also check that sensors are clean and properly aligned. The app itself doesn't reduce the need for physical tune-ups.

Why is my garage door so loud even after lubrication? Noise often signals worn rollers, hinges, or track misalignment rather than lack of lubrication. A professional inspection will identify the source. Sometimes the fix is simple; other times replacement parts are needed for lasting quiet operation.
